Profile:
Enid was one of the Pillars of the World, who was chosen by Lareg eons ago, to join forces with the Dual-bladed Occamist Monk, the Crystal Glyphic Lunarian and the Sonorous Navarchaic Warrior to defeat the beast who had control of the world. She received the spirit of Lareg that could be tapped into using the rings of Lareg. The spirit of Lareg gave her immortality, and thus she remains youthful to today.
Some decades ago, She started the Melnian Mystics in Sion to train young girls to become Mystics who were to protect the world from being enslaved by the undead. When the secret weapon of the undead made its first appearance, she had used the Love Ring of Lareg to seal away the creature's power, but when that seal broke 5 years ago, she renewed it with the second Hurt Ring of Lareg. Now she battles against the undead Lich Skull Master, as the Great Exalted Mother of the Melnian Mystics, to protect the creature from falling into their hands. and to give him a peaceful life as far as possible. But she does not know that the real purpose of the creature's existence.
Enid holds many secrets in her heart. She must have, after being alive in the world for so long. The burden of keeping the world safe from the undead gets to her sometimes, but she perseveres as she awaits the return of her king. She enjoys nature and the finer things in life, for example, she often recites poetry and tells stories to the younger Mystics. Many people, not just the Mystics, look to her as a wise counsellor and someone they can turn to for guidance, which she generally shares from her experience of having lived for around a thousand years.
Her eye colour is one of the rarest colours in the world. Only a handful of people ever had eyes like hers and they were all legends in their time. It has also been said that those who gaze into her eyes sometimes feel like they are falling into a deep pool, which some say that is the innermost reaches of her soul.
